一种驻留小区调整方法及用户设备的制造方法

文档序号:9755517阅读:362来源:国知局
一种驻留小区调整方法及用户设备的制造方法
【技术领域】
[0001]本发明涉及通信技术领域,具体涉及一种驻留小区调整方法及用户设备。
【背景技术】
[0002]随着微电子技术的发展,智能手机等用户设备的功能越来越多,用户可以通过智能手机即时通信、订餐、订票、娱乐等。
[0003]营运商的基站所承载的用户数量是有限的。当同一个小区用户数量比较多时,会降低该小区用户通信速率,影响通信体验,例如在火车站、地铁站等人群密集场所,有限的基站难以满足大量用户同一时段的通话需求。

【发明内容】

[0004]本发明实施例提供了一种驻留小区调整方法及用户设备,以期避免用户设备接入已过度繁忙的小区,有利于提升用户设备的通话质量。
[0005]本发明实施例第一方面提供一种驻留小区调整方法,包括:
[0006]在检测到用户设备的系统时间处于预设高峰通话时段内时,获取用户设备的位置对应的N个小区中每一个小区接入的用户设备的数量,所述N为正整数;
[0007]确定所述N个小区中接入的用户设备的数量最少的小区为参考小区;
[0008]若所述参考小区接入的用户设备的数量大于预设数量阈值,则确定接入的用户设备的数量小于所述预设数量阈值、且与所述用户设备的位置之间的距离最近的小区为目标小区;
[0009]当检测到所述用户设备处于所述目标小区的信号覆盖区域时,控制所述用户设备驻留至所述目标小区。
[0010]本发明实施例第一方面第一种可能的实现方式中,所述控制所述用户设备驻留至所述目标小区之后,所述方法还包括:
[0011]检测所述用户设备的通话电流;
[0012]在检测到所述用户设备的通话电流大于预设电流阈值时,获取通话电流小于所述预设电流阈值的M个参考通话电流,以及所述M个参考通话电流对应的M个参考通话位置,所述M为正整数;
[0013]确定所述M个参考通话位置中与所述用户设备的位置之间的距离满足预设条件的参考通话位置为目标通话位置;
[0014]输出用于提示用户转移至所述目标通话位置的提示消息。
[0015]结合本发明实施例第一方面或第一方面第一种可能的实现方式中,在本发明实施例第一方面第二种可能的实现方式中,所述获取用户设备所处的位置对应的N个小区中每一个小区接入的用户设备的数量,包括:
[0016]向用户设备的位置对应的N个小区中每一个小区发送数量获取请求;
[0017]接收所述每一个小区响应所述数量获取请求而发送的接入的用户设备的数量。
[0018]结合本发明实施例第一方面或第一方面第一种或第二种可能的实现方式中,在本发明实施例第一方面第三种可能的实现方式中,所述确定接入的用户设备的数量小于所述预设数量阈值、且与所述用户设备的位置之间的距离最近的小区为目标小区之后,所述控制所述用户设备驻留至所述目标小区之前,所述方法还包括:
[0019]输出用于提示用户转移至所述目标小区进行通话的提示消息;
[0020]或者,
[0021]振动并输出用于提示用户转移至所述目标小区进行通话的提示消息;
[0022]所述提示消息至少包括以下任意一种:语音提示消息、文字提示消息以及图片提示消息。
[0023]结合本发明实施例第一方面或第一方面第一种或第二种或第三种可能的实现方式,在本发明实施例第一方面第四种可能的实现方式中,所述方法还包括:
[0024]若所述参考小区接入的用户设备的数量小于或等于预设数量阈值,则控制所述用户设备驻留至所述参考小区。
[0025]本发明实施例第二方面提供了一种用户设备,包括:
[0026]获取单元,用于在检测到用户设备的系统时间处于预设高峰通话时段内时,获取用户设备的位置对应的N个小区中每一个小区接入的用户设备的数量,所述N为正整数;
[0027]确定单元,用于确定所述N个小区中接入的用户设备的数量最少的小区为参考小区;
[0028]所述确定单元,还用于若所述参考小区接入的用户设备的数量大于预设数量阈值,则确定接入的用户设备的数量小于所述预设数量阈值、且与所述用户设备的位置之间的距离最近的小区为目标小区;
[0029]驻留单元,用于当检测到所述用户设备处于所述目标小区的信号覆盖区域时,控制所述用户设备驻留至所述目标小区。
[0030]在本发明实施例第二方面第一种可能的实现方式中,所述用户设备还包括:
[0031]检测单元,用于检测所述用户设备的通话电流;
[0032]所述获取单元,还用于在所述检测单元检测到所述用户设备的通话电流大于预设电流阈值时,获取通话电流小于所述预设电流阈值的M个参考通话电流,以及所述M个参考通话电流对应的M个参考通话位置,所述M为正整数;
[0033]所述确定单元,还用于确定所述M个参考通话位置中与所述用户设备的位置之间的距离满足预设条件的参考通话位置为目标通话位置;
[0034]输出单元,用于输出用于提示用户转移至所述目标通话位置的提示消息。
[0035]结合本发明实施例第二方面或第二方面第一种可能的实现方式,在本发明实施例第二方面第二种可能的实现方式中,所述获取单元获取用户设备所处的位置对应的N个小区中每一个小区接入的用户设备的数量的具体实现方式为:
[0036]向用户设备的位置对应的N个小区中每一个小区发送数量获取请求;
[0037]接收所述每一个小区响应所述数量获取请求而发送的接入的用户设备的数量。
[0038]结合本发明实施例第二方面或第二方面第一种或第二种可能的实现方式,在本发明实施例第二方面第三种可能的实现方式中,所述用户设备还包括:
[0039]第一消息输出单元,用于在所述确定单元确定接入的用户设备的数量小于所述预设数量阈值、且与所述用户设备的位置之间的距离最近的小区为目标小区之后,所述驻留单元控制所述用户设备驻留至所述目标小区之前,输出用于提示用户转移至所述目标小区进行通话的提示消息;
[0040]或者,
[0041]第二消息输出单元,用于在所述确定单元确定接入的用户设备的数量小于所述预设数量阈值、且与所述用户设备的位置之间的距离最近的小区为目标小区之后,所述驻留单元控制所述用户设备驻留至所述目标小区之前,振动并输出用于提示用户转移至所述目标小区进行通话的提示消息;
[0042]所述提示消息至少包括以下任意一种:语音提示消息、文字提示消息以及图片提示消息。
[0043]结合本发明实施例第二方面或第二方面第一种或第二种或第三种可能的实现方式,在本发明实施例第二方面第四种可能的实现方式中,
[0044]所述驻留单元,还用于若所述参考小区接入的用户设备的数量小于或等于预设数量阈值,则控制所述用户设备驻留至所述参考小区。
[0045]本发明实施例第三方面提供了一种用户设备,包括:
[0046]存储有可执行程序代码的存储器;
[0047]与所述存储器耦合的处理器;
[0048]所述处理器调用所述存储器中存储的所述可执行程序代码,执行如下步骤:
[0049]在检测到用户设备的系统时间处于预设高峰通话时段内时,获取用户设备的位置对应的N个小区中每一个小区接入的用户设备的数量,所述N为正整数;
[0050]确定所述N个小区中接入的用户设备的数量最少的小区为参考小区;
[0051]若所述参考小区接入的用户设备的数量大于预设数量阈值,则确定接入的用户设备的数量小于所述预设数量阈值、且与所述用户设备的位置之间的距离最近的小区为目标小区;
[0052]当检测到所述用户设备处于所述目标小区的信号覆盖区域时,控制所述用户设备驻留至所述目标小区。
[0053]在本发明实施例第三方面第一种可能的实现方式中,所述处理器控制所述用户设备驻留至所述目标小区之后,所述处理器还用于:
[0054]检测所述用户设备的通话电流;
[0055]在检测到所述用户设备的通话电流大于预设电流阈值时,获取通话电流小于所述预设电流阈值的M个参考通话电流,以及所述M个参考通话电流对应的M个参考通话位置,所述M为正整数;
[0056]确定所述M个参考通话位置中与所述用户设备的位置之间的距离满足预设条件的参考通话位置为目标通话位置;
[0057]输出用于提示用户转移至所述目标通话位置的提示消息。
[0058]结合本发明实施例第三方面或第三方面第一种可能的实现方式,在本发明实施例第三方面第二种可能的实现方式中,所述处理器获取
当前第1页1 2 3 4 5 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1